About [Edit]
The Not In Our Name Project is a national network of individuals and
organizations committed to standing with the people of the world. As the Not
in Our Name Pledge of Resistance states, "we believe that as people living
in the United States it is our responsibility to resist the injustices done
by our government, in our names." Our mission is to build, strengthen and
expand resistance to stop the U.S. government's entire course of war and
repression being waged in the name of "fighting terrorism." This course has
three main components:
The War on the World - The U.S. government has engaged in preemptive
military actions and wars and brazenly states its determination to "change
regimes" where it sees fit, promising wars that will last a generation and
supplying arms and aid used to terrorize people around the world.
Detentions, Deportations and Roundups of Immigrants - The U.S. government
has effectively stripped immigrants, especially Arabs, Muslims and South
Asians, of rights, in laws and acts reminiscent of the very tyranny from
which our government is supposedly liberating people.
Police State Restrictions - The U.S. government has instituted stark new
repressive measures, such as the U.S. PATRIOT and Homeland Security Acts,
designed to create fear, intimidate opposition and silence dissent.
